Factors Influencing Stem Cell Treatment Costs: What to Take into Account

Undergoing stem cell treatment can be a complex and costly journey. The price tag for these procedures varies widely depending on several crucial factors. A key consideration is the kind of stem cells used, with adult stem cells generally being less costly than embryonic stem cells. The intensity of your condition also plays a role, as more complex treatments naturally command higher costs. Geographic location can influence prices due to differences in regulatory standards and market demand. Additional factors include the reputation of the treatment center, the number of treatment sessions required, and any associated medical costs. It's crucial to thoroughly research and compare different providers to determine the most cost-effective and suitable option for your individual needs.

Insurance Coverage for Stem Cell Therapies: Expectations and Realities

Access to innovative approaches like stem cell therapy often hinges on the complex interplay between medical necessity, scientific evidence, and insurance coverage. Patients frequently harbor optimistic expectations regarding insurance imbursement, envisioning a seamless path to these potentially transformative therapies. However, the reality often proves more challenging. Stem cell therapy remains an evolving field, with ongoing investigation striving to define its efficacy and safety for various conditions. This uncertainty can present hindrances for insurers in determining appropriate coverage policies.

  • Therefore, many patients face considerable financial challenges when pursuing stem cell therapy, often requiring out-of-pocket expenses that can be substantial.
  • Furthermore, the lack of standardized guidelines and regulatory frameworks for stem cell therapies complicates the insurance review process.

Navigating this landscape requires patients to engage in informed discussions with their healthcare providers, negotiate actively with insurance companies, and explore alternative financing options.
